Released
Nov 24, 2014
Album
BEYONCÉ [Platinum Edition]
Beyoncé
Haunted
BPM
67
Duration
6:09
Key
12A
Released
Nov 24, 2014
Album
BEYONCÉ [Platinum Edition]
Released
Nov 24, 2014
Album
BEYONCÉ [Platinum Edition]
BPM
67
Duration
6:09
Key
12A
Released
Nov 24, 2014
Album
BEYONCÉ [Platinum Edition]